http://www.axtora.com/homesites/us/wisconsin/st-croix-falls/content/80a5f67b4d5552392eed0261977f9847.html Mitch Olson grew up in BloomerBut he received his football education on the Chippewa Falls football sidelinesI was always a Chippewa kid said Olson who started attending Chippewa Falls schools in eighth grade I was on the sidelines as a ball boy ever since first grade Always grew up around ChiHi football It was nice to be able to play at such a special placeOlson whose father Bart is a Chippewa Falls assistant did more than just wear a Redbirds jersey He was on the varsity as a sophomore was an allconference defensive back as a junior and rarely left the field as a senior He played an integral role in what one of the best twoyear runs in Chippewa Falls history The Cardinals went 173 in Olson's junior and senior years including two victories over rival Menomonie and a perfect 140 mark in the Big Rivers ConferenceThat was more than enough to make Olson the 57th annual LeaderTelegram AllNorthwest player of the yearHe was 100 percent dedicated to the sport and ChiHi football Cardinals coach Chuck Raykovich said His success was not an accidentHe was a threeyear varsity player at Chippewa Falls playing on offense defense and special teams after spending his childhood tagging along with his father Bart a Cardinals assistantIt was at quarterback where Olson's true football smarts shone through Raykovich and offensive coordinator Ed Watkins added some new looks to the Cardinals' offense to take advantage of Olson's athleticism sometimes straying away from the traditional doublewing look But even in the doublewing Olson needed to be on his game He had the responsibility to look over the defense and make adjustments if necessaryIf they had Hudson's Seth Stanchik or Menomonie's Kyle Ahrens on one side you'd go up to the line and flip it said Olson who has a 398 GPAThe best example of Olson's leadership came in a 2827 overtime victory over Superior at Dorais Field The Cardinals blew a 140 lead and found themselves trailing by a touchdown with 4 minutes 24 seconds left The offense which gained just one first down since the middle of the second quarter took over at its own 45We never thought we were going to lose Olson said We came out and played hard and did what we needed to do Everyone knew it was time to go to workOlson was the firestarter He wasn't perfect but he made things happen First it was a 9yard screen pass to running back Michael Adams Then it was a 14yard strike to Cole Zwiefelhofer on thirdand10 A pass interference call on Superior gave the Cardinals another first down Then Olson capped the drive with one of the gutsiest 7yard runs you'll ever see a quarterback make The Cardinals went on to win the game in overtime with Olson throwing a touchdown passHe has credibility because of the time and effort he put into the program Raykovich said He wasn't just a shouter He was a doer It's easy to believe people like thatOlson was named cooffensive player of the year in the Big Rivers and was firstteam allBig Rivers at both quarterback and defensive backThe only thing missing from Olson's resume is playoff success The Cardinals were ousted in the first round the past two seasons Olson had to watch as his boyhood teammates from Bloomer made a run in the Division 4 playoffs beating St Croix Falls and Mondovi before falling to BaldwinWoodvilleBut Olson doesn't think about what could have been had he stayed in BloomerI never once regretted my decision Olson said So happy I went to Chippewa Falls Tons of great opportunities and lots of great people I had a chance to meetThere will be football in Olson's future He's just not sure where He's taken official visits to MinnesotaMoorhead and Winona State both Division II schools He's going to take three moreMost of the schools are looking at him to play defense but now that film from his senior year is starting to circulate some may want him at quarterbackI want to keep my options open Olson said I just love playing football Whatever side of the football that may be on I just want to play at the next levelOlson's cousin Brett Olson was the AllNorthwest player of the year in 2004 Brett Olson was a quarterback for Eau Claire RegisRunning backsOlson heads a backfield that include's Zack Pomputis of OwenWithee Levi Johnson of River Falls and Bucky Dixon of HaywardPomputis runnerup for player of the year honors moved up from last year's second team He led the Blackhawks to a 73 record as the team's MVPHe carried 244 times for 1824 yards and 24 touchdowns at a 75 average per carry He also caught nine passes for 172 yards and totaled 166 pointsHe is the complete running back speed quickness vision balance and a great knowledge of where his blocks are coming from to give him the cutback lanes he is looking for coach Terry Laube saidHe led northwest Wisconsin runners with the aid of five games of more than 200 yards including a high of 266 against Wisconsin Rapids Assumption In his final game he rushed for 117 yards against Division 6 state finalist Edgar In his threeyear career he totaled 4728 yards and scored 56 touchdownsJohnson averaged 77 yards a try against big school rivals totaling 1541 yards on 199 carries and scoring a total of 23 touchdownsThe senior rushed for a high of 247 yards against Eau Claire North scoring four touchdowns He scored a high of five touchdowns in just nine rushing attempts in a win over Rice Lake in which he played in only the first half Levi has speed toughness and the ability to stop and start on a dime North coach Dean Rosemeyer said He is always a threat to scoreJohnson was selected cooffensive player of the year in the Big Rivers Conference and raised his twoyear career total to more than 2700 yardsHe runs with incredible determination great lateral movement tremendous burst and great toughness River Falls coach John Bennett saidDixon was a literal workhorse for Hayward which fashioned a 90 regular season and won the Heart O'North ConferenceThe senior rushed 339 times for 1780 yards and 24 touchdowns at a 52 average per carry In those 339 carries Dixon fumbled just once He hit a high of 57 carries for 252 yards and scored both touchdowns in a key 147 win over LadysmithA very durable running back Barron coach Chad Buss said He helped carry Hayward to the conference championshipDixon finished his career with 3051 yards and 42 touchdownsWide receiversThe receivers are Jarrod Martell of Chippewa Falls McDonell and Joel Effertz of LadysmithMartell a secondteamer a year ago helped McDonell gain a spot in the playoffs with his offensive fireworksHe caught 47 passes for 775 yards and 13 touchdowns and totaled 16 touchdowns in all The figures represented Marawood Conference highsHe's just a great athlete McDonell coach Todd Brown said He goes after the ball He's very athleticHe upped his twoyear totals to 94 catches for 1630 yardsEffertz drew rave notices from opponents for his allaround ability on both sides of the ball and as a kickerHe's the best player in the whole area said Woody Keeble Ladysmith coach A tight end Effertz caught 32 balls for 547 yards and nine touchdowns for the Lumberjacks He also averaged 389 yards on 52 puntsHe's going to Arizona on a baseball scholarshipOffensive
